About West Mining Corp.

https://www.westminingcorp.ca/

West Mining Corp. is a mineral exploration company focused on acquiring and developing prospective advanced and early-stage projects for gold, copper, and silver deposits. The company is dedicated to advancing its exploration and development efforts, primarily targeting projects in British Columbia. Its portfolio includes the 100% owned Junker Project and the Spanish Mountain West Project. The company also holds interest in the Kena Project, which has been optioned to Upside Gold Corp.
